I am thinking of going to this. I thought I would put it up early because it always sells out quick. The Sunday Passport to Pinot is in the Oak Grove at Linfield College in McMinnville. It is your chance to actually meet the winemakers, taste Pinot from 75 different wineries and enjoy food from some of the best chefs in the Northwest. It is pricey though $150.

"A condensed version of the IPNC, the Sunday Passport to Pinot offers guests a chance to taste through all 74 Pinot noir wines from our Featured Wineries! The Passport to Pinot takes place in the beautiful Oak Grove of Linfield College, providing a wonderful setting for this relaxed outdoor tasting. In addition to 74 wineries, 15 local Northwest chefs will be preparing culinary treats to pair with your Pinot. The IPNC will also be pouring a selection of aged Pinot noir from our library. Unlike the Salmon Bake, the Passport to Pinot is not included for Full Weekend Guests. It is considered a separate event from the Full Weekend festivities and attracts a separate crowd of 500 Pinot noir fans."
